Mix crunchy peanut butter in a bowl with a bit of sweet chilli sauce, a bit of lime juice and some boiling water to soften it, adjust chilli sauce and lime to taste. Easy and delicious.

3 tbsp peanut butter
1 tbsp dark soy sauce
1 tbsp Rice wine vinegar
1 tsp sesame oil
1 clove garlic minced
I piece ginger minced
1 or 2 red chillis finely chopped

Whisk together over a low heat and loosen with water as needed.

For two portions I mix 2 tbsp peanut butter, juice of 1/2 lime, tbsp soya sauce, 1/2 tbsp sesame oil, pinch each of paprika and turmeric and tsp sriracha then pour a bit of boiling water into it and mix. The peanut butter separates at first and it looks really disgusting but keep mixing and it all comes together in a nice smooth sauce.
